Police still looking for shooter of teen

November 26, 2011 By Times-Herald Newspapers Leave a Comment

By JAMES MITCHELL
Sunday Times Newspapers

TAYLOR — Police are investigating a Nov. 20 shooting that wounded a 19-year-old man in the 15500 block of the Court Village apartment complex.

Police Cmdr. Mary Sclabassi said witnesses reported a confrontation between two groups of men that began around 3 p.m. Sunday in the complex near the intersection

of Eureka and South Beech Daly roads. Shots were fired, one of which hit the victim in the abdomen. Sclabasi said the victim is in stable condition and expected to recover.

No suspect is yet in custody as the investigation continues.

Police are requesting anyone with information to call (734) 287-6611.
